Transaction fd8604069159a95eb057f7fec79490fc41ac099d2033c6545d68ea75edc9e748

2 Input
2 Outputs
  • fd8604069159a95eb057f7fec79490fc41ac099d2033c6545d68ea75edc9e748:0
  • value  1011290
    address  3DeAXJYsyjxgBY4bcDQegFKzr1jiFjp1oS
  • fd8604069159a95eb057f7fec79490fc41ac099d2033c6545d68ea75edc9e748:1
  • value  1145533
    address  189ipReqatanDuY8F9xK38rDRuqgcAzUtx